Summary

A guide to everything the gardener needs to know about climbing plants. The author suggests specific plants for different zones of the wall and takes the reader through the process of vertical planting. He also advises on concealing ugly features and the construction of trellises and pergolas.

Ramblers, Scramblers and Twiners Summary

Ramblers, Scramblers and Twiners by Michael Jefferson-Brown

Climbers dress up fences, disguise ugly areas, provide seclusion, and add lushness. Here are 500 high-performance ramblers, scramblers, and twiners that will work in every zone of your garden. Practical advice on setting up effective supports, making a pergola, and avoiding damage to house walls.

Table of Contents

Part 1 Planning and planting: challenges and opportunities; space, illusion and plants; walls, fences, screens; pergolas and other structures; support aids; planting and plant association; water, feeding and maintenance. Part 2 The walls: walls and microclimates; the three wall zones; the north-facing wall; the south-facing wall; the east-facing wall; the west-facing wall. Part 3 The plants: self-clinging climbers; twiners; ramblers and scramblers; wall shrubs; wall base plants; annuals; the more tender plants.
